Anker 735 Charger (GaNPrime 65W)

65W compact USB-C charger with GaN technology. Three ports (2 USB-C, 1 USB-A) for charging multiple devices simultaneously. Compact foldable plug design for portability. Intelligent power distribution with PowerIQ 4.0.

Amazon Fire TV Stick 4K Max (2nd Gen)

Stream in 4K Ultra HD with support for Dolby Vision, HDR10+, and Dolby Atmos. Wi-Fi 6E support for smoother streaming. Ambient Experience turns TV into smart display. Fire TV Alexa Voice Remote Enhanced with backlit buttons. 16GB storage with faster app loading.

Anker Nano Power Bank 10000mAh

Compact 10000mAh portable charger with built-in USB-C connector. 30W max output charges phones quickly. Foldable connector design. LED display shows remaining battery percentage. Charges iPhone to 50% in about 30 minutes.

Are cheap wireless earbuds any good?

The good ones are, yeah. The Anker Soundcore Space A40 at $50 has active noise cancellation and sounds better than earbuds that cost twice as much. You're obviously not getting AirPods Pro quality, but for casual listening, commuting, and calls, they're more than enough.

Is the Fire TV Stick worth it if they already have a smart TV?

Usually yes. Most smart TV interfaces are slow and clunky compared to the Fire TV Stick. It's faster, has more apps, and gets updates longer. Plus Alexa voice search actually works well. It's a $40 upgrade that makes a $500 TV feel better.

What's a good tech gift for older parents or grandparents?

The Echo Pop or Echo Dot. Set it up for them before you give it, connect it to their Wi-Fi and music account. They can ask for weather, set timers, play music, and make calls without touching a screen. It's the tech gift that actually gets used instead of collecting dust.
